Subject: [PATCH v2 1/2] dt-bindings: regulator: add PF0900 regulator yaml

Add device binding doc for PF0900 PMIC driver.

Signed-off-by: Joy Zou <joy.zou@....com>
---
Changes for v2:
1. modify the binding file name to match compatible string.
2. add one space for dt_binding_check warning.
3. remove unnecessary quotes from "VAON".
4. remove the unnecessary empty line.
5. move unevaluatedProperties after the $ref.
6. move additionalProperties after regulator type.
7. remove unnecessary regulator description

diff --git a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/regulator/nxp,pf0900.yaml b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/regulator/nxp,pf0900.yaml
new file mode 100644
index 0000000000000000000000000000000000000000..55cfe9ad5c5c24b47d5a806985e092e279755064
--- /dev/null
+++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/regulator/nxp,pf0900.yaml
@@ -0,0 +1,169 @@
+# S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0-only OR BSD-2-Clause
+%YAML 1.2
+---
+$id: http://devicetree.org/schemas/regulator/nxp,pf0900.yaml#
+$schema: http://devicetree.org/meta-schemas/core.yaml#
+
+title: NXP PF0900 Power Management Integrated Circuit regulators
+
+maintainers:
+  - Joy Zou <joy.zou@....com>
+
+description:
+  The PF0900 is a power management integrated circuit (PMIC) optimized
+  for high performance i.MX9x based applications. It features five high
+  efficiency buck converters, three linear and one vaon regulators. It
+  provides low quiescent current in Standby and low power off Modes.
+
+properties:
+  compatible:
+    enum:
+      - nxp,pf0900
+
+  reg:
+    maxItems: 1
+
+  interrupts:
+    maxItems: 1
+
+  regulators:
+    type: object
+    additionalProperties: false
+
+    properties:
+      VAON:
+        type: object
+        $ref: regulator.yaml#
+        unevaluatedProperties: false
+
+    patternProperties:
+      "^LDO[1-3]$":
+        type: object
+        $ref: regulator.yaml#
+        unevaluatedProperties: false
+
+      "^SW[1-5]$":
+        type: object
+        $ref: regulator.yaml#
+        unevaluatedProperties: false
+
+        properties:
+          nxp,dvs-run-microvolt:
+            minimum: 300000
+            maximum: 1350000
+            description:
+              PMIC default "RUN" state voltage in uV.
+
+          nxp,dvs-standby-microvolt:
+            minimum: 300000
+            maximum: 1350000
+            description:
+              PMIC default "STANDBY" state voltage in uV.
+
+  nxp,i2c-crc-enable:
+    type: boolean
+    description: If the PMIC OTP_I2C_CRC_EN is enable, you need to add this property.
+
+required:
+  - compatible
+  - reg
+  - interrupts
+  - regulators
+
+additionalProperties: false
+
+examples:
+  - |
+    #include <dt-bindings/interrupt-controller/irq.h>
+
+    i2c {
+        #address-cells = <1>;
+        #size-cells = <0>;
+
+        pmic@8 {
+            compatible = "nxp,pf0900";
+            reg = <0x08>;
+            interrupt-parent = <&pcal6524>;
+            interrupts = <89 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_LOW>;
+            nxp,i2c-crc-enable;
+
+            regulators {
+                VAON {
+                    regulator-name = "VAON";
+                    regulator-min-microvolt = <1800000>;
+                    regulator-max-microvolt = <3300000>;
+                    regulator-boot-on;
+                    regulator-always-on;
+                };
+
+                SW1 {
+                    regulator-name = "SW1";
+                    regulator-min-microvolt = <500000>;
+                    regulator-max-microvolt = <3300000>;
+                    regulator-boot-on;
+                    regulator-always-on;
+                    regulator-ramp-delay = <1950>;
+                };
+
+                SW2 {
+                    regulator-name = "SW2";
+                    regulator-min-microvolt = <300000>;
+                    regulator-max-microvolt = <3300000>;
+                    regulator-boot-on;
+                    regulator-always-on;
+                    regulator-ramp-delay = <1950>;
+                };
+
+                SW3 {
+                    regulator-name = "SW3";
+                    regulator-min-microvolt = <300000>;
+                    regulator-max-microvolt = <3300000>;
+                    regulator-boot-on;
+                    regulator-always-on;
+                    regulator-ramp-delay = <1950>;
+                };
+
+                SW4 {
+                    regulator-name = "SW4";
+                    regulator-min-microvolt = <300000>;
+                    regulator-max-microvolt = <3300000>;
+                    regulator-boot-on;
+                    regulator-always-on;
+                    regulator-ramp-delay = <1950>;
+                };
+
+                SW5 {
+                    regulator-name = "SW5";
+                    regulator-min-microvolt = <300000>;
+                    regulator-max-microvolt = <3300000>;
+                    regulator-boot-on;
+                    regulator-always-on;
+                    regulator-ramp-delay = <1950>;
+                };
+
+                LDO1 {
+                    regulator-name = "LDO1";
+                    regulator-min-microvolt = <750000>;
+                    regulator-max-microvolt = <3300000>;
+                    regulator-boot-on;
+                    regulator-always-on;
+                };
+
+                LDO2 {
+                    regulator-name = "LDO2";
+                    regulator-min-microvolt = <650000>;
+                    regulator-max-microvolt = <3300000>;
+                    regulator-boot-on;
+                    regulator-always-on;
+                };
+
+                LDO3 {
+                    regulator-name = "LDO3";
+                    regulator-min-microvolt = <650000>;
+                    regulator-max-microvolt = <3300000>;
+                    regulator-boot-on;
+                    regulator-always-on;
+                };
+            };
+        };
+     };
